add --sysroot option
--root is not sufficient to properly operate on a mounted guest system.
Using --root still uses the host system's configuration and there is no
way to correctly use the guest configuration without manually modifying
any Include directives. --sysroot provides an easier way to operate on
a guest system by chrooting immediately after option parsing before
configuration parsing or performing any operations. It is currently
limited to the root user, but that's enough for restoring a guest system
to a working state, which is the primary intended use case.
